The Bell Food Group is one of the leading processors of meat and convenience food in Europe. The product range includes fresh meat, poultry, charcuterie, seafood as well as ultra-fresh, fresh and non-perishable convenience and vegetarian products. With the brands Bell, Hilcona, Hรผgli and Eisberg, the Group meets a diversity of customer needs. Its customers include the retail trade as well as the food service sector and the food processing industry. The Bell Food Group is a market leader in Switzerland and in individual product segments in several European countries. Some 13 000 employees in 14 countries generate annual sales of more than CHF 4.5 billion. Steeped in tradition, the company was established in 1869 when Samuel Bell opened his first butcherสผs shop in Basel. The Bell Food Group is listed on the Swiss stock exchange.
